Megan Fox London Transformers 2 Premier

This was one of the stops on the transformer 2 tour. For sure one of my favorite looks of the tour. The rain may have been hard on hair but i loved the moist glow of megans skin. A sexy smokey eye and a sheer lip.

The infamous “Rose Boy” incident – it was loud, bright and crowded as megan returned to the hotel after premiere. She never saw the boy offering the rose – but the media decided to paint a picture of insensitivity onto megan and next thing we knew this boy was getting his 15 minutes plus. Front page news and onto prime time television. crazy….